WORKSHOP DESCRIPTION:

Recognizing “Substance Abuse” early and referring the client to appropriate professional/community
resources can make a huge difference. This can often be the key to success for many of our clients.

This full day interactive training will provide you with the knowledge and skills to effectively recognize,
understand, and assess for “Substance Abuse” and consequently equip you with the information to
successfully connect the client with appropriate community/professional resources.


 

    Participants will be able to:

 
  • understand the rules that govern treatment services
  • learn how to identify the signs and symptoms of abuse/addiction
  • understand the complexity of drug and alcohol addiction
  • understand how drugs and alcohol influence families
  • learn how to identify potential harm and what steps to take
  • be introduced to the language of treatment planning and understand how
    information between organizations will result in a better outcome for the client
  • be able to determine the way in which a client’s readiness for change influences
    the outcome of treatment and the appropriate level of care
  • learn how to locate the appropriate resources in their community for referrals

(This workshop has been designed for frontline staff, case managers and counselors who are either new to their roles or as a refresher to those who already hold these positions, and supervisory staff.)
